Once upon a time, in a cozy little house in the forest, lived a family of bears. Papa Bear was very big, Mama Bear was of medium size, and Baby Bear was small. One morning, Mama Bear served the most delicious porridge for breakfast, but it was too hot to eat, so the three bears decided to go for a walk in the forest while it cooled down.

After a few minutes, a little girl named Goldilocks arrived at the bear's house and knocked on the door. Finding no answer, she opened the door and went into the house without permission.

In the kitchen, there was a table with three bowls of porridge: a large one, a medium one, and a small one. Goldilocks, who was very hungry, thought the porridge looked delicious.

First, she tried the porridge from the large bowl, but it was too cold and she didn't like it. Then, she tried the porridge from the medium bowl, but it was too hot and she didn't like that either.

Finally, she tasted the porridge from the small bowl and it was just right! It was neither too cold nor too hot, it was perfect! The porridge was so tasty that she ate it all up without leaving a bit.

After eating the bears' breakfast, Goldilocks went to the living room. There were three chairs in the room: a big one, a medium one, and a small one.

First, she sat on the big chair, but it was too high and she didn't like it. Then, she sat on the medium chair, but it was too wide and she didn't like that either.

Then she found the small chair and sat on it, but the chair was fragile and broke under her weight. Looking for a place to rest, Goldilocks went up the stairs.

At the end of the hallway, there was a room with three beds: a big one, a medium one, and a small one. First, she climbed onto the big bed, but it was too hard and she didn't like it.

Then, she climbed onto the medium bed, but it was too soft and she didn't like that either. Finally, she lay on the small bed, which was neither too hard nor too soft. It felt perfect! Goldilocks fell fast asleep.

After a while, the three bears returned from their walk in the forest. Papa Bear immediately noticed that the door was open.

"Someone has been in our house without permission, sat in my chair, and tasted my porridge," said Papa Bear in a voice filled with anger.

"Someone sat in my chair and tasted my porridge," said Mama Bear in a slightly annoyed voice.

Then, Baby Bear said in his small voice, "Someone ate all my porridge and broke my chair." The three bears went up the stairs.

Upon entering the room, Papa Bear said, "Someone has slept in my bed!" And Mama Bear exclaimed, "Someone has slept in my bed too!"

Baby Bear cried, "Someone is sleeping in my bed!" and began to cry uncontrollably.

The crying of Baby Bear woke up Goldilocks, who was very scared, jumped out of the bed, and ran down the stairs.

The three bears watched in surprise as Goldilocks fled their home, running into the forest as fast as her little legs could carry her.

They looked at each other in disbelief, stunned by the intrusion and the mess she had left behind. But even though they were upset, they felt relieved that she was gone.

From that day onwards, the three bears made sure to lock their house whenever they went out for a walk. And as for Goldilocks, she learned a valuable lesson that day about respecting other's property.

They continued to live happily in their little house in the forest, knowing that they were safe from any future intruders. As for Goldilocks, she never ventured far from home again, always remembering the scary encounter with the three bears.
